QF5001 Brass Thermowell Ball Valve – Integrated Temperature Sensor Port for Heating & HVAC Systems

The Coliter® QF5001 Brass Thermowell Ball Valve is a lead-free, full-port ball valve with an integrated thermowell port designed for temperature monitoring in heating, solar thermal, and HVAC systems. The built-in thermowell allows insertion of a temperature probe or sensor without system shutdown, enabling real-time fluid temperature measurement while maintaining a sealed, leak-free connection. Constructed from forged brass with a chrome-plated ball and PTFE seats, it ensures reliable bubble-tight shut-off and smooth quarter-turn operation. The valve features ISO 228 (BSP) parallel threads and is rated at PN16 (1.6 MPa), suitable for water, non-corrosive liquids, and saturated steam within a temperature range of -20°C to 110°C. Compliant with WRAS and ACS standards, the QF5001 combines flow control and temperature sensing functionality in a single compact unit—ideal for boiler outlets, heat exchangers, and district heating circuits.

Technical Specifications

Nominal Pressure:1.6 MPa
Working Medium:Water, Non-corrosive Liquids, Saturated Steam
Working Temperature:-20℃ ≤ t ≤ 110℃
Pipe Threads:ISO 228

Coliter® offers a comprehensive range of lead-free brass ball valves for residential, commercial, and light industrial applications. Our portfolio includes full-bore designs with lever or knob handles, available in female/male/union thread configurations (BSP ISO 228), extended stems for buried installations, and specialized variants with filters or thermowells. All valves feature PTFE seats, chrome-plated balls, and are rated at PN16 (1.6 MPa), suitable for water, oil, gas, and saturated steam up to 110°C. Compliant with WRAS, ACS, and GB/T 17241 standards, Coliter brass ball valves deliver bubble-tight shut-off, low torque operation, and long service life across plumbing, heating, irrigation, and utility systems.
